Common Myths About Plinko and Crash Games
I already mentioned the ‘rigged’ myth. But here is another one. People think that if you bet more, you will win more often. That is not how it works. The multiplier is random. Betting £10 instead of £1 does not change the odds of hitting the big payout. It just changes how much you lose if you are wrong. Always bet what you are comfortable losing.

What is the house edge on Plinko?
It varies by game, but typically it is around 3% to 5%. That is lower than many slot games. But it still means the casino has an advantage over time. Play for fun, not to get rich.
